US stock futures pointed lower Monday morning, with E mini S&P 500 contracts down around 1%, as investors weighed falling bond yields against a cooling housing backdrop. The US 10 year Treasury yield slipped to about 4.5% after softer inflation readings, while pending home sales dropped 5.4% in June and 30 year mortgage rates sat at 6.55%. Among top movers, Travelers Companies jumped 9.22% after Q2 earnings, dividend affirmation, and a buyback update, while Intuitive Surgical fell 14.15% after multiple analysts cut price targets following Q2 results and slower procedure growth. On the radar, earnings from Alphabet, Tesla, General Motors, and housing-linked stocks are due over the next three sessions.
